Need to Know

Free parking. Portable restroom and pavilion at the start. Well-shaded trail.

Description

Line Creek Nature Area is a heavily trafficked trail system located near Peachtree City, Georgia. The trail is primarily used for hiking, walking, and bird watching. Dogs are also able to use this trail but must be kept on leash.

Terrain is rocky in some areas, but otherwise it's fun, quick trail when not busy.
